Assistant to President/CEO and Board Liaison

The Greater Miami Jewish Federation seeks a highly organized, self-motivated, and mission-driven professional to join our team as Assistant to President/CEO and Board Liaison.Working closely with the President/CEO and the Executive Office on a richly diverse set of responsibilities and projects, the successful candidate will interact regularly with top-tier volunteer leaders and donors, Federation’s Senior Management Team, and various members of the community.

The ideal candidate has a minimum of 3-4 years professional experience, a bachelor’s level college degree, excellent writing skills, and proficiency in the basic Microsoft Office suite of programs, including Word, Excel, Outlook, and PowerPoint. Familiarity with Jewish culture and traditions is highly desirable.

Specific Responsibilities:

The Assistant to the President/Chief Executive Officer and Board Liaison reports directly to the President/CEO providing staff support to the Board of Directors, Executive Committee, and Nominating Committee; managing special projects; assisting with correspondence; and offering personalized service to the top tier of Federation volunteer leaders and donors. 

Assistant to the President and Chief executive Officer

  • Assist President/CEO with correspondence with major donors, community leaders, and Federation officers and board members.
  • Responsibility for a variety of special projects and tasks assigned by President/CEO.
  • Create periodic reports to specific philanthropic foundation donors for accountability and stewardship.

Board of Directors

  • Coordinate Board of Directors and Executive Committee meetings, including preparation of agendas, reports, notes for Chair of the Board, and attendance reports.
  • Prepare Minutes of each meeting.
  • Update Board Manual, Staff Directory, and Glossary of Federation terms for new Board members.
  • Manage New Board Orientation for incoming members of the Board.

Board of Directors Nominating Process

Manage Nominating Process including identifying members of the Nominating Committee, recommendations for new Board members, and appointment of Standing Committee Chairs and other positions.

  • Staff Nominating Committee meeting.
  • Prepare a Board report for Board of Directors meeting.
  • Work with Marketing & Communications to produce annual Board slate for publication.
  • Work with Marketing & Communications to update GMJF letterhead annually.

General Responsibilities

  • Coordinate attendance and payments for Federation professionals at agency or communal events.When appropriate, provide congratulatory letters for agency ad journals.
  • Research and provide documentation to the Director of Philanthropic Initiatives regarding potential donors.Assist with correspondence as needed.
  • Work with Marketing & Communications to produce documents pertaining to Board of Directors, including Roll of Honor, Annual Report, and Federation letterhead.

Bylaws Revisions (as needed)

  • Research recent bylaws changes from other Federations and governance best practices.
  • Manage process for bylaws revisions and present for Board of Directors approval.

V.I.P. Services:

  • Provide or arrange for donors to have access to people and places where opportunities for education and inspiration are of interest.
  • Provide full range of concierge services to top-tier Federation volunteer leaders and donors as requested.
